Understanding Short-Term Disability Insurance: Why It's Necessary and Affordable Options to Consider
Short-Term Disability Insurance (STDI) is a safety net that protects your income during unforeseen periods of illness or injury, ensuring financial stability when you can’t work. It’s particularly crucial for those with unstable jobs or no long-term disability coverage. STDI provides a percentage of your income while you recover, helping meet essential expenses and preventing debt accumulation.
When looking for affordable short-term disability insurance, compare various options in the market. Many providers offer competitive rates, especially when tailored to specific needs. Cheaper short-term insurance for cars and other high-value assets is readily available, but ensure the policy covers your income adequately. Consider factors like waiting periods, coverage duration, and renewable options to find the best fit without breaking the bank.
How to Choose the Right Cheap Short-Term Insurance Coverage for Your Car and Income Protection Needs
When exploring cheap short-term insurance for car and income protection, understanding your needs is key. Begin by assessing the scope of coverage required. Consider factors such as your vehicle’s value, repair costs, and potential downtime if it’s damaged or totaled. For income protection, determine how much financial support you need during a period of disability. This could be a percentage of your salary or a fixed amount to cover essential expenses.
Next, compare various insurance providers offering cheap short-term car and disability policies. Look for companies that specialize in temporary coverage, as they often have more flexible plans. Review policy terms, deductibles, and exclusions carefully. Ensure the coverage aligns with your needs, providing adequate protection without unnecessary costs. Opting for higher deductibles can reduce premiums, but make sure you’re comfortable with the out-of-pocket expenses.
